Show value as days and hours and aggregate

So i'm trying to display the below value in the format "x days, y hours" but when i change the format, it does not aggregate being a text output. Has anyone worked on this? Can we have the value in the background but still display as human readable format of days and hours.

need to update the days value from decimal format such as 6.375 days --> 6 days 9 Hrs 

 

Hi @lalTel20 ,

 

Sorry for my late reply.

Below is how I show you how to display the change from 6.375 days to 6 days 9 Hrs.

First, create a calculated column as follows.

DATEDIFF is to get the hours of the time difference. Divide the number of hours calculated by 24 to get the number of days, and then multiply by 100 plus the remainder of the number of hours divided by 24.

For example, _hours=153 → 609

DayHours = var _hour=DATEDIFF([Start Duration],[End Duration],HOUR)
return INT(DIVIDE(_hour,24))*100+MOD(_hour,24)/100

And then create a custom format like

vstephenmsft_0-1638932292848.png

Now, "609" is changed to "6Days09Hrs".

vstephenmsft_1-1638932300950.png

"None" should be seleceted in Display units.
